Management Commentary

During the associated the previous quarter earnings call, Zepp leadership focused discussions largely on strategic operational priorities rather than deep dives into unreported financial line items. Management noted that the negative EPS for the quarter aligns with the company’s previously communicated strategy of prioritizing near-term investments in next-generation product development to support long-term market positioning. Specific areas of investment highlighted during the call include research into new biometric sensor technology, AI-powered diagnostic feature integration for existing wearable devices, and expansion of enterprise partnerships with hospital systems and corporate wellness programs. Leadership also referenced ongoing cost optimization efforts across non-core operational functions, intended to offset some of the increased R&D and business development spending in the current operating period. Forward Guidance

Zepp did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ance for future periods alongside the the previous quarter earnings release, per public disclosures. The qualitative outlook shared by management noted that the company may continue to allocate a significant share of its operating budget to R&D and market expansion initiatives in the near term, which could lead to continued fluctuations in profitability as these investments are rolled out. Management also noted that the company is exploring potential new market entry opportunities in high-growth regions where demand for affordable health wearables is rising, though no specific timelines for these expansions were shared. Analysts covering the health tech sector estimate that Zepp’s focus on enterprise health partnerships could support future revenue diversification, though these contributions may take multiple operating periods to materialize, based on typical sales cycles for enterprise healthcare technology solutions. Market Reaction

Following the release of the the previous quarter earnings results, trading activity in ZEPP shares was in line with recent average volume levels in the first few sessions after the announcement, as investors digested the limited available financial data. Analyst reactions to the results have been mixed: some industry analysts note that the negative EPS signals persistent near-term cost pressures that may weigh on operational performance in the coming months, while others highlight that the company’s ongoing investments in differentiated health tech features could potentially help it capture share in the fast-growing remote health monitoring market. Broader industry trends, including rising consumer demand for preventative health tools and growing adoption of remote patient monitoring by healthcare providers, may act as potential tailwinds for Zepp’s core business, though competition from larger, more diversified consumer technology firms operating in the wearable space could pose potential headwinds for the company’s market share growth over time.
